Herbert Vojčík
|
7065818073
amberc: -l libraries not used to construct compiler. Fixes #888
|
10 年之前 |
Herbert Vojčík
|
1d088fd7a5
Some more {js,st}=>src fixes.
|
10 年之前 |
Herbert Vojčík
|
86ba69e399
Don't write program if undefined. Fixes #878.
|
10 年之前 |
Herbert Vojčík
|
80b2dfec0a
No program is ok, resolve instead of reject. Fixes #877.
|
10 年之前 |
Nicolas Petton
|
f8c679c125
Renames js/ to src/
|
10 年之前 |
Herbert Vojčík
|
259c51c2c0
'smalltalk' variable changed to 'vm' inside amberc
|
10 年之前 |
Manfred Kroehnert
|
7c7a5aeb43
amberc.js: globalJsVariables is defined on the smalltalk, not the globals object
|
10 年之前 |
Manfred Kroehnert
|
2f8949728b
amberc: update to latest 'globals' changes
|
10 年之前 |
Manfred Kroehnert
|
2bbc1dd5ec
amberc.js: reject if no program file is given, rename AmberC to AmberCompiler, update logging output
|
10 年之前 |
Herbert Vojčík
|
7f7057cd37
Fixed empty program & resolve in com_js_fil (by mkroehnert)
|
10 年之前 |
Herbert Vojčík
|
459c39141e
'Compile Time' only in verbose; finished_callback checked for null
|
10 年之前 |
Herbert Vojčík
|
5e3fa0cc94
Promise code lighter; errors thrown are shown.
|
10 年之前 |
Nicolas Petton
|
39300f4c1d
fixes amberc.js for recent changes in master
|
10 年之前 |
Manfred Kroehnert
|
b9b8ab5302
amberc.js: create resolve_file() function
|
11 年之前 |
Manfred Kroehnert
|
bef2a806fe
amberc.js: call finished_callback() once the compiler is done
|
11 年之前 |
Manfred Kroehnert
|
a758127788
amberc.js: createDefaults() renamed to createDefaultConfiguration()
|
11 年之前 |
Manfred Kroehnert
|
8ee008c856
amberc.js: fully assemble configuration before checking it
|
11 年之前 |
Manfred Kroehnert
|
ed5aa7805f
amberc.js: documentation fixes
|
11 年之前 |
Manfred Kroehnert
|
fc103a7733
amberc.js: compose_js_files() resolves into configuration
|
11 年之前 |
Manfred Kroehnert
|
25d1527cfb
amberc.js: merge resolve_compiler() and create_compiler()
|
11 年之前 |
Manfred Kroehnert
|
1d818a2f32
amberc.js: merge readFiles() into compile()
|
11 年之前 |
Manfred Kroehnert
|
5249eb8461
amberc.js: resolve_js now returns a Promise
|
11 年之前 |
Manfred Kroehnert
|
f17dcf50d9
amberc.js: readFiles() comes before compile()
|
11 年之前 |
Manfred Kroehnert
|
d5f4c37229
amberc.js: remove last occurences of defaults variable
|
11 年之前 |
Manfred Kroehnert
|
1b509b5502
amberc.js: rename error callback into reject
|
11 年之前 |
Manfred Kroehnert
|
15ed62e46d
amberc.js: verify() and category_export() return a single Promise; add logError() function
|
11 年之前 |
Manfred Kroehnert
|
e9e3b25608
amberc.js: fix compile time calculation + restore console.log
|
11 年之前 |
Manfred Kroehnert
|
f6719caddc
amberc.js: remove self.defaults reference
|
11 年之前 |
Manfred Kroehnert
|
d50e69c047
amberc.js: merge collect_files() into AmberC.main()
|
11 年之前 |
Manfred Kroehnert
|
1274ff6ac8
amberc.js: finally remove the Combo construct
|
11 年之前 |